H*3546 (Rat #0276, Act #0181 of 1993) General Bill, By Sheheen, Boan, R.S. Corning, B.H. Harwell, J.H. Hodges, Jennings, P.H. Thomas and Wilkins
Similar (H 3611)
    A Bill to amend Title 1, Code of Laws of South Carolina, 1976, relating to administration of government by adding Chapter 30, so as to establish within the Executive Branch of State Government nineteen departments and to establish within each department certain divisions composed of specified state agencies, to provide for the organization, governance, duties, functions, and procedures of the various departments and divisions, and for the manner of selection, terms, and removal of department heads, board and commission members, and other officials, to provide that certain other agencies other agencies or departments of state government shall perform their duties and functions as a part of and under the supervision of designated Constitutional or statutory officers, to amend Chapter 23 of Title 1 of the 1976 Code, relating to state agency rule making and adjudication of contested cases by adding Article 5, so as to establish the South Carolina Administrative Law Judge Division the judges of which shall hear, determine, and preside over contested cases of certain state agencies, departments, divisions, and commissions, to amend the State Administrative Procedures Act so as to revise the manner in which regulations are approved and take effect, to abolish specified boards, commissions, and committees of this State, to provide for transitional provisions in regard to this Act, to provide for effective dates, and to amend certain Sections.-short title

02/23/93House Introduced and read first time HJ-8
02/23/93House Referred to Committee on Judiciary HJ-8
03/08/93House Recalled from Committee on Judiciary HJ-32
03/09/93House Objection by Rep. Wilkins, Hodges, McLeod, Beatty & Haskins HJ-11
03/09/93House Amended HJ-31
03/09/93House Debate interrupted HJ-96
03/10/93House Amended HJ-14
03/10/93House Debate interrupted HJ-150
03/11/93House Amended HJ-25
03/11/93House Read second time HJ-74
03/11/93House Roll call Yeas-103 HJ-74
03/25/93House Amended HJ-20
03/25/93House Read third time and sent to Senate HJ-21
03/25/93House Roll call Yeas-090 HJ-21
03/30/93Senate Introduced and read first time SJ-16
03/30/93Senate Referred to Committee on Judiciary SJ-27
05/11/93Senate Recalled from Committee on Judiciary SJ-8
05/11/93Senate Read second time SJ-20
05/11/93Senate Ordered to third reading with notice of amendments SJ-20
05/13/93Senate Debate adjourned SJ-27
05/17/93Senate Amended SJ-19
05/17/93Senate Read third time and returned to House with amendments SJ-55
05/20/93House Senate amendment amended HJ-26
05/20/93House Returned to Senate with amendments HJ-27
05/20/93Senate Non-concurrence in House amendment SJ-34
05/25/93House House insists upon amendment and conference committee appointed Reps. Hodges, Clyborne & Boan HJ-5
05/25/93Senate Conference committee appointed Sens. Moore, Stilwell, Jackson SJ-12
06/02/93Senate Free conference powers granted SJ-85
06/02/93Senate Free conference committee appointed Sens. Moore, Stilwell, Jackson SJ-85
06/02/93House Free conference powers granted HJ-100
06/02/93House Free conference committee appointed Boan, Hodges & Clyborne HJ-101
06/14/93House Free conference report received and adopted HJ-6
06/14/93Senate Free conference report received and adopted SJ-24
06/14/93Senate Ordered enrolled for ratification SJ-28
06/15/93 Ratified R 276
06/18/93 Signed By Governor
06/18/93 Act No. 181
